Comprehending the Role of an Injury Lawsuit Lawyer
An injury lawsuit lawyer is an attorney who provides legal representation to those who declare to have been injured, physically or mentally, as an outcome of the negligence or misbehavior of another individual, business, government agency, or other entity.
Their primary goal is to protect settlement (called "damages") for their clients to cover medical expenses, rehab, lost income, and discomfort and suffering.
Core Responsibilities of an Injury Attorney:
- Case Evaluation: Assessing the benefits of a case based upon liability, damages, and offered evidence.
- Investigation: Gathering authorities reports, medical records, witness declarations, and professional testimonies.
- Negotiation: Communicating and negotiating strongly with insurance provider for a fair settlement.
- Lawsuits: Filing an official suit, performing discovery, and representing the customer in a law court if a settlement can not be reached.
When Should You Hire a Lawyer?
Not every small scrape or fender-bender needs the services of a legal professional. Nevertheless, certain circumstances require the expertise of a certified injury claim lawyer.
Common Scenarios Requiring Legal Representation:
- Severe or Permanent Injuries: If the injury results in long-term impairment, disfigurement, or substantial rehabilitation, calculating the future expense of care is complicated and needs legal competence.
- Contested Liability: When the other celebration or their insurer denies fault, a lawyer is necessary for collecting the evidence required to show negligence.
- Numerous Parties Involved: Accidents including commercial trucks, numerous lorries, or faulty products often include linked liabilities that are challenging to untangle without legal help.
- Insurance Bad Faith: If an insurance provider acts unreasonably by denying a legitimate claim, postponing payment, or using an unbelievably low settlement, a lawyer can take legal action versus them.
- Wrongful Death: If an enjoyed one passes away due to another person's neglect, surviving relative should immediately seek advice from a lawyer to file a wrongful death claim.

How much does an injury lawsuit lawyer cost? Most personal injury legal representatives run on a contingency charge basis. This means you pay absolutely nothing upfront. Rather, the lawyer takes an agreed-upon percentage(typically in between 33%and 40% )of the last settlement or court award. If you recover absolutely nothing, you owe them no attorney costs. 2. How long do I have to file an Accident Injury Lawsuit Representation lawsuit? Every state has a time frame understood as the statute of restrictions. For a lot of individual injury cases, this window varies from one to three years from the date of the accident. Stopping working to file within this timeframe typically bars you from ever recuperating settlement. 3. Will my case go to trial? Statistically, the vast majority of Personal Injury Attorney injury cases (around 90% to 95%) are settled out of court through negotiation or mediation. Nevertheless, hiring a lawyer who is fully prepared to take your case to trial gives you substantial take advantage of throughout settlement discussions, as insurer understand the attorneyis not afraid to face them in court. 4. What kind of damages can I recuperate? Victims can typically seek 2 primary types of countervailing damages: Economic Damages: Objectively verifiable losses such as medical costs, property damage, lost wages,and loss of future earning capacity.
Non-Economic Damages: Subjective losses such as pain and suffering, emotional distress, loss of consortium, and loss of pleasure of life.
